Showing posts with the label deepest river

The Congo River is the deepest river in the world with lots of strange fish

The Congo River is the deepest river in the world with lots of strange fish Get to know the Congo River, the deepest river in the world and lots of strange fish - The Congo River, located…
The Congo River is the deepest river in the world with lots of strange fish
OlderHomeNewest